AI/ML Engineer
Toulouse
France
ā¬75000.00/year
Permanent
Space Situational Awareness/SST
Darwin Space are currently hiring for an AI/ML Engineer on behalf of a business in Toulouse.
About the Role
They are an AI/ML Engineer to build and deploy learning-driven capabilities within their autonomous space systems. In this role, you’ll create models that directly operate in closed-loop autonomy, supporting perception, navigation, and decision-making in real mission environments. This is a hands-on position for engineers who want their models running on real spacecraft, not just evaluated in offline experiments.
Job Description
* Design, train, and validate AI/ML models supporting satellite autonomy, including rendezvous and proximity operations, on-orbit inspection, formation flying, and space domain awareness.
* Develop learning-based components for guidance, navigation, perception, and decision-making, such as pose estimation, anomaly detection, behavior recognition, and trajectory generation.
* Build LLM- and VLM-powered tools to enable intuitive satellite operations, including natural language command interfaces and visual scene understanding.
* Create and maintain synthetic data generation pipelines that model realistic orbital dynamics, sensor behavior, lighting conditions, and uncertainty, using domain randomization and sim-to-real techniques.
* Extend and improve simulation environments used for training, verification, stress testing, and adversarial evaluation of autonomy models.
* Optimize models for flight deployment, applying techniques such as quantization, pruning, batching, and real-time inference on limited onboard compute.
* Integrate ML components into flight software using well-structured Python and C++ interfaces, with strong safeguards and fallback behaviors.
* Participate in software-in-the-loop and hardware-in-the-loop testing, closing the feedback loop between simulation, sensors, control systems, and model improvements.
* Take full ownership of your models, from early experimentation and training pipelines to testing, review, deployment, and long-term maintenance.
Requirements
* Strong foundation in machine learning, deep learning, reinforcement learning, or a related technical discipline.
* Practical experience developing, training, and evaluating ML models for perception, estimation, planning, or control systems.
* Proficiency with modern ML frameworks such as PyTorch or TensorFlow, and the ability to integrate models into Python and C++ systems.
* Experience building simulation tools or data generation pipelines to support ML development.
* Ability to design, debug, and scale training workflows, including dataset management, distributed training, and evaluation.
* Familiarity with deploying ML inference as part of larger autonomous or robotic software stacks.
* A sense of ownership, adaptability in fast-paced environments, and clear communication around technical tradeoffs.
Darwin Recruitment is acting as an Employment Agency in relation to this vacancy.
Sebastian Prins
To Apply for this Job Click Here
Submit Your CV
Similar Jobs
Permanent
Staff Systems EngineerSpace
Launch Services / Propulsion
Staff Systems Engineer Location: United States, Onsite Compensation Range: 150,000 to 190,000 USD per year, plus equity and benefits We are a rocket and See more…
to $190000.00/year
San Francisco
USA
Permanent
Product Assurance EngineerSpace
Aircraft Manufacturing
Darwin Space are currently hiring for a Product Assurance Engineer behalf of a business in Spain. Ensure the reliability and safety of breakthrough space See more…
to ā¬50000.00/year
Bilbao
Spain
Permanent
CFOSpace
Other
Darwin Space are currently hiring for a CFO on behalf of a business in Italy. The CFO will assume full responsibility for the organization’s See more…
to ā¬75000.00/year
Italy